SyntheticDrugOn Wednesday, January 21 about 5:40 p.m. the Marshall County 9-1-1 dispatch center advised the Bremen Police Department of a possible impaired driver who was northbound on State Road 331 from 7th Road, south of Bremen.

At 5:45 p.m. Bremen Officers located and stopped the vehicle at State Road 331 and 2B Road. After an investigation by Bremen Officers it was determined that the driver was impaired. Officers also located synthetic marijuana in the vehicle.

Chad Hartsell, 33 years of age from Bremen was incarcerated in the Marshall County Jail on a complaint of Operating While Intoxicated and Possession of synthetic marijuana.  His cash bond was set at $1,505 and he was given a February 10th court date in Superior Court II.
